Mounts Frequently Asked Questions
What types of mounts are available for surveillance cameras?
There are several types of mounts available for surveillance cameras, including wall mounts, pole mounts, pendant mounts, and junction boxes. Each type serves a specific purpose, allowing for flexible installation options based on the camera's location and the environment. For example, wall mounts are ideal for fixed installations, while pole mounts can be used for cameras on tall structures.
How do I choose the right mount for my camera?
To choose the right mount for your camera, consider the camera's weight, the installation surface, and the desired angle of view. Ensure that the mount can support the camera's weight and is compatible with its design. Additionally, evaluate the environment where the camera will be installed, as some mounts are designed for outdoor use and may offer weather resistance.
Can I use the same mount for different camera models?
While some mounts are compatible with various camera models, many are designed specifically for certain types or brands. It is crucial to check the mount's specifications and compatibility with your camera model before purchasing. Using an incompatible mount can lead to instability or damage to the camera.
What materials are commonly used for camera mounts?
Camera mounts are typically made from materials such as aluminum, steel, or plastic. Aluminum and steel mounts are preferred for their durability and strength, especially in outdoor settings, while plastic mounts may be used for lighter indoor applications. The choice of material can affect the mount's longevity and ability to withstand environmental conditions.
Are mounts adjustable for different angles and positions?
Many camera mounts feature adjustable components that allow for changing angles and positions. These adjustments can help optimize the camera's field of view and ensure it captures the desired area. However, not all mounts have this capability, so it is important to verify the adjustability of a specific mount before purchasing.
